# Environments — Wrenport Messaging Gateway

Wrenport's websocket layer enables per-message compression in staging but not production. The tradeoff: compression cuts bandwidth roughly in half but, for security review purposes, note that compressing attacker-influenced frames alongside secrets raises oracle concerns, which is why production disables it on authenticated channels. Dev mirrors staging. Any change to these flags requires sign-off before promotion. The current per-environment settings are recorded below.

deployment values, yadug-bawif:
[framir]
team = pelox
access_code = ac_a38ab2
owner = tamion.julael
host = framir.tolvaqlabs.test
port = 11211
peer = tammir.zemvargrid.local
salt = 2215ef03
pin = 1541

**Onboarding — ChipGate reader access**

Welcome. The ChipGate timing-chip readers for the Harrowfield Marathon sync results to the Pylon server every 30 seconds. Your first task: confirm each reader's clock before race day. Admin console lives on the trackside laptop. If the console locks (it will, idle timeout is aggressive), you'll need the recovery credentials. Don't write them anywhere else. Talk to Ines if anything looks off. The recovery passphrase for the console is below.

unlock words, yawig-kagef: gordor-holvan-ulaael-pramir-ulaiel-tamdor

## Tuning the reader

If the Striderline chip reader starts dropping reads at the Oakhollow finish mat, don't panic — it's almost always the debounce or antenna gain. Bump things gently, one knob at a time, and watch the miss rate between adjustments. The knobs you actually care about are these.

tuning table, kahop-tawig:
CAPS = {
    "aldix": 1008,
    "oliax": 81,
    "casok": 299,
    "sordor": 409,
    "sormir": 822,
}

Management Meeting Minutes — Licensing Dispute

Attendees reviewed the ongoing dispute with Corvane Labs over the Metterly toolkit license. Counsel advised that branch use of version 4 should pause pending clarification of field-of-use terms. Managers must log any customer-facing deployments by Friday. Settlement talks resume next month in Ashworth. Branch managers should treat the appended note below as strictly confidential.

internal memo for fajog-yagaf: Gross margin on Ulaael came in at 20 percent against a plan of 10 percent. Only 9 of the 80 pilot accounts renewed Ulaael, so a churn review is set for July 1.